  20. Had to find the Celeb at the point, and fight off the lvl 54 waves of Malta (first with an AV), while escorting them to WB. Once into WB, had to escort them to the Launch Computer (where ya actually launch rockets).

    Was an interesting event, but it did serve to highlight two issues on how I13 PvP failed.

    1. There was a lot of surprise and or shock at the PvE/PvP powers change when we went into WB. Several melee toons went from mainstays to useless, owing to the differences in mez protection. It doesn't make PvP easier or more newbie friendly if the powers you've learned for 30+ levels completely change in effect and affect. Also, was an interesting wrinkle in bringing it to a FFA PvP zone, since we needed more than one team to make it through the NPC ambushes... but had no way to prevent friendly fire once out of the confines of the starting base.

    2. Many people both during event and after commented that they'd have brought a different character had they known it was going to be PvP. If this event was to expose more players to PvP, it could have been better presented, CoH/V has little or no history with PvEvP activities on a large scale (zones are deserted enough that Shivan and Rocket Hunting are a trivial exercise). Also, while I appreciated and actually enjoyed the short notice, more clarity in directions or goals could have been useful.


    All in all, I had a blast doing it, and would look forward to more little "events" as such in the future, just feel the execution could have been handled better. Thanks for the fun.
